site stats

Excel vba check if row is empty

WebJan 14, 2024 · I'm trying to write an IF statement in VBA to determine if the first column along the row of a listbox is empty. If the row is empty I want a message box to display. if the row is not empty then the row is saved to memory. My code so far: WebClose the Properties window and right-click on the scroll bar again. This time, select “ View Code ” from the context menu. This will open the Visual Basic Editor, where you can enter the code to make the text scroll. In the editor window, you should see some code that looks like this: Plain text. Copy to clipboard.

VBA Determine if Table body is empty MrExcel Message Board

WebDec 31, 2009 · for a string, you can use If strName = vbNullString or IF strName = "" or Len (strName) = 0 (last one being supposedly faster) for an object, you can use If myObject is Nothing for a recordset field, you could use If isnull (rs!myField) for an Excel cell, you could use If range ("B3") = "" or IsEmpty (myRange) WebJun 20, 2024 · Creating the Pivot Table. To create a Pivot Table, perform the following steps: Click on a cell that is part of your data set. Select Insert (tab) -> Tables (group) -> PivotTable. In the Create PivotTable dialog … holistic management and planned grazing https://prismmpi.com

IsEmpty function (Visual Basic for Applications) Microsoft …

WebOct 28, 2024 · Visual Basic Application or VBA , when used in Microsoft Excel, is an efficient tool, as repetitive jobs can be automated with its help. Users can even write custom VBA code to meet their programming needs. Using interesting properties like offset, one can operate across different cells in Excel. Operations like selecting the next empty cell in a … WebDec 15, 2024 · Once you can identify which rows are blank, either based on a single or multiple cells you can. delete the blank rows by using the Data Filter to view the blank … WebCheck IF Multiple Cells Empty. If you want to check and count the empty cells from a range when you need to loop through each cell in the range. Sub vba_check_empty_cells() Dim i As Long Dim c As Long Dim myRange As Range Dim myCell As Range Set myRange = Range("A1:A10") For Each myCell In myRange c = c + 1 If IsEmpty(myCell) Then i = i … holistic management handbook

Check if Cells in Row are Empty - OzGrid Free Excel/VBA Help Forum

Category:excel - What to do when autofilter in VBA returns no data

Tags:Excel vba check if row is empty

Excel vba check if row is empty

EXCEL VBA - Loop through cells in a row, if not empty, copy cell …

WebNov 14, 2024 · I tried many codes, but always it write the messing box, even when the columnB has no empty cell. One of the code is. For Each cell In Range (Range ("A4").End (xlDown).Offset, Range ("A4").End (xlDown).End (xlUp)).Offset (0, 1) If IsEmpty (cell) = True Then GoTo Done1 End If Done1: MsgBox "In column B are empty cells.", … WebMar 2, 2024 · A cell that contains an empty string, "", is not empty anymore, but it looks like it. You can test it like this: In a new worksheet write in A1: ="" (there is no space in between!) Copy A1 and special paste values in A1. A1 now looks to be empty. Run Debug.Print IsEmpty (Range ("A1").Value) in VBA and you get a FALSE.

Excel vba check if row is empty

Did you know?

WebJun 22, 2024 · You can efficiently check if all the cells in a range are empty by using Application.CountA in the following way: If Application.CountA (rg) = 0 Then ' all cells are empty. Sub EmptiesInDer () ' Reference the worksheet ('ws'). Dim ws As Worksheet: Set ws = ActiveSheet ' improve! ' Reference the range ('rg'). WebJun 7, 2024 · Something like this: Code: Public Sub Test () Dim oBlank As Range Dim oTestRange As Range Dim oSheet As Worksheet Set oSheet = ActiveSheet 'Adjust …

WebNov 25, 2024 · If you want to find the next empty row in column A try something like this. Code: With Sheets ("Data") NextRow = .Range ("A" & Rows.Count).End (xlUp).Row+1 .Range ("B" & NextRow) = TextBox1.Value End With Note this is psuedo code as the code you posted and your explanation are hard to follow. 0 R rafikarp New Member Joined … WebSep 1, 2010 · WorksheetFunction.CountA (), as demonstrated below: Dim row As Range Dim sheet As Worksheet Set sheet = ActiveSheet For i = 1 To sheet.UsedRange.Rows.Count Set row = sheet.Rows (i) If WorksheetFunction.CountA …

WebClose the Properties window and right-click on the scroll bar again. This time, select “ View Code ” from the context menu. This will open the Visual Basic Editor, where you can … WebJul 8, 2016 · Here's another way to do it without VBA. Select Blanks (CTRL+G, Click Special, Select Blanks, OK) In formula bar, type =(CELL DIRECTLY ABOVE THE FIRST BLANK) ex: IF A2 is blank, =A1; HOLD CTRL, press enter to commit formula to all blank cells. Select range, copy and paste values if necessary to remove the formulas.

WebJun 7, 2024 · Public Function CheckTbl (tbl As ListObject) As Boolean With tbl Dim bempty As Boolean 'Check if table is empty If .DataBodyRange Is Nothing Then bempty = True Else 'Table must not be empty bempty = False End If End With CheckTbl = bempty End Function 0 CubaRJ New Member Joined Mar 21, 2024 Messages 18 Office Version 365 …

WebApr 12, 2024 · Filtering Out the Blank Rows. To combat the above problem of zero-filled rows, we can use the FILTER function to eliminate non-empty rows provided by the VSTACK function. In other words, filter out the blank rows. ... NOTE: As Excel VBA does not possess a “worksheet rename” event trigger to force the macro to run automatically, … holistic management financial planningWebFeb 5, 2024 · You could use InsertRowRange for the first row but there is probably a neater way to do all of this. You appear to want to insert a new row each time and populate from the data. So, use ListObject.ListRows.Add() to add the row: human causes for droughtWebNov 5, 2024 · lastrow = .ListRows.Count If lastrow > 0 Then If Application.WorksheetFunction.CountA(.ListRows(lastrow)) = 0 Then .ListRows(lastrow).Delete End If End If End With Next Display More It should loop through all the tables on the activesheet, and if the last row is blank, it should delete that row. holistic management of employee riskWebHow to delete empty rows or rows with blank cells in Excel. 5 easy-to-use macro code examples that can help you now. Detailed step-by-step explanations. ... This Excel VBA Delete Blank or Empty Rows Tutorial is accompanied by Excel workbooks containing the data and macros I use. ... This makes sense since you want Excel to check each row of ... human cause of urbanizationWebApr 18, 2016 · Sub T () Dim rng As Range Set rng = Range ("B1:K10") ' Since you're going to loop through row 1 to 10, just grab the blank cells from the start rng.SpecialCells (xlCellTypeBlanks).EntireRow.Select ' Just to show you what's being selected. Comment this out in the final code rng.SpecialCells (xlCellTypeBlanks).EntireRow.Delete End Sub holistic mannerWebNov 19, 2004 · If you place the cursor in the A column of the row in question and check that it is empty (Press F2 to ensure that the cell does not contain just spaces) and then press End and then the Right Arrow, it will take you to the cell that is causing the macro to fail. Let us know what you find. TJ. Oh dear I need a beer. holistic manner meaningholistic man